ASSEMBLY STEP 5
Set the Tension
•  
Insert a screwdriver tip into one of the nut ring slots 
and brace it firmly against the trolley.
•  
Place a 7/16" open end wrench on the square end. 
Rotate the nut about 1/4 turn until the spring releases 
and snaps the nut ring against the trolley.
This sets the spring to optimum belt tension.

IMPORTANT IN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S
To reduce the risk of SEVERE INJURY or DEATH:

1.   READ AND FOLLOW ALL INSTALLATION WARNINGS AND 
INSTRUCTIONS.
2.   Install garage door opener ONLY on properly balanced and 
lubricated garage door. An improperly balanced door may 
NOT reverse when required and could result in SEVERE 
INJURY or DEATH. 
3.   ALL repairs to cables, spring assemblies and other 
hardware MUST be made by a trained door systems 
technician BEFORE installing opener.
4.   Disable ALL locks and remove ALL ropes connected to 
garage door BEFORE installing opener to avoid 
entanglement.
5.   Install garage door opener 7 feet (2.13 m) or more above 
floor.
6.   Mount the emergency release within reach, but at least 
6 feet (1.8 m) above the floor and avoiding contact with 
vehicles to avoid accidental release.
7.   NEVER connect garage door opener to power source until 
instructed to do so. 
  8.  NEVER wear watches, rings or loose clothing while 
installing or servicing opener. They could be caught in 
garage door or opener mechanisms.
  9. Install wall-mounted garage door control:  
    •  within sight of the garage door. 
    •   out of reach of children at minimum height of 5 feet 
(1.5 m).
    •  away from ALL moving parts of the door.
10.  Place entrapment warning label on wall next to garage 
door control.
11.  Place manual release/safety reverse test label in plain view 
on inside of garage door.
12.  Upon completion of installation, test safety reversal 
system. Door MUST reverse on contact with a 1-1/2" 
(3.8 cm) high object (or a 2x4 laid flat) on the floor.
